    Deserve the Michelin 3 stars. Summary: View from restaurant: 7/10 Renovation/Design: 8/10 (Personal preference, am a classy retro, fond of classics. One thing to pick on, lights are too yellowish) Atmosphere: 7/10 (Quite and comfy.) Service: 7/10 Food (Taste 8/10 Plating 8/10 Ingredient 9/10) Overall comments: You can feel the heart, passion and effort the chef put in the dishes. The preparation work is highly appreciated and you will be moved. If you are a tourist, highly recommend you to go to Caprice, it worths a journey to HK just to try this restaurant. If you had been to quite a few Michelin 3 stars restaurants in HK and around the world like me, this is a place that you would love to come again for fine dining and for special occasions) Details: Appetizer -Foie gras, Salmon with Caviar, Crispy potato with Curry (The Crispy potato with Curry surprises us, innovative, but the taste is a bit strong as an appetizer) - Beef Tartare with 10g White Truffle – freshly arrived on the day (If I am to pick on, the white truffle was claimed to arrived on the day. The white truffle had lost some of its scent and flavor compared to what I had in the International Alba White Truffle Fair in Italy in which I tried the freshest white truffle first hand. I know I can’t compare what I had in Alba, Italy with that in Caprice. But still, best chef strive for the best) - Foie gras with apple - Live Alaskan King Crab with Caviar & Eatable Gold (Caviar not too salty, preserved and handled well with no fishy smell) Soup - Onion soup with Onion ice cream and cheeze crispy (one of the best dish I have in this meal. Innovative. Surprising. The sorbet is rich in onion smell. The salty cheeze cracker balanced the sweetness of the sorbet) Main: - France Pigeon with Vietnam Cacao, with Foie Gras (If I am to pick on , the Foie Gras is super greasy. I am not a fan of Foie Gras so if you like greasy food like Japanese A5 Wagyu you may like it ) - France Pigeon with Vietnam Cacao, with Foie gras - Red Muller with Saffron source Desert: -Small cake, chocolate -Lemon refresher -A dessert special for my birthday

  • 5/5 Cindy X. 3 years ago on Google
    Hands down probably one of the best dining experiences I’ve had. The food is overall great, and the service is just phenomenal. Kudos to the manager, Ms. Janet (I hope I get the name right). We went for birthday celebration, and we are glad we chose caprice for it. The waitress explained the dishes nicely, which added our appreciation to the food served. We chose the 5 courses lunch set menu, I wont describe all of the food, but my favorite is the pigeon, lobster bisque, the tomato with burrata and Their bread!! Their bread is just lovely, it has the crunch and the softness of the bread that I love. The lobster bisque is packed with flavors, the tomatoes are so nice to have as appetiser, and the pigeon is soft and juicy (although my friends said it is a bit fishy, but I am okay with that). The dessert is also nice, and the petit fours is lovely. It is an expensive lunch, but I am happy with the food and service served. Worth it to try.

  • 4/5 Gina P. 4 years ago on Google
    Took the Dinner menu - service was as expected, excellent staff including the sommelier. Food - each dish was correct and a perfect specimen of what it should be, however I would have expected something extra from a 3 michelin star restaurant, I was left thinking there could be a little more impressions. Fantastic bread, cheese, patisserie/desserts. French onion soup was a little too sweet and salty. If Caprice can impress without resorting to foie gras and caviar as fallbacks, I will be a repeat return patron. Also, I missed the chef at the end of the meal - no opportunity to provide feedback was given. Still, a good restaurant all in all.
